What is a Focus Session Calculator?
A focus session calculator helps you structure your workday using proven productivity techniques like the Pomodoro Technique, Deep Work blocks, and custom focus intervals. By calculating optimal work-break ratios, you can maximize productivity while preventing burnout. Research shows that structured focus sessions with regular breaks can increase productivity by up to 40% compared to unstructured work.
Popular Focus Techniques
Different techniques work for different people and tasks:
- Pomodoro Technique: 25 minutes of focused work followed by 5-minute breaks. After 4 sessions, take a 15-30 minute long break. Best for tasks requiring sustained attention.
- Deep Work (90/20): 90-minute deep focus blocks followed by 20-minute breaks. Based on ultradian rhythms. Ideal for complex creative or analytical work.
- 52/17 Method: 52 minutes of work followed by 17-minute breaks. Balance between Pomodoro and Deep Work. Good for general productivity.
- Custom Intervals: Set your own work-break ratios based on your energy patterns and task requirements.
The Science of Focus
Research in cognitive psychology shows:
- Attention span: Most people can maintain peak focus for 25-90 minutes before needing a break
- Ultradian rhythms: Our brains naturally cycle through 90-120 minute focus periods followed by 20-minute rest periods
- Break benefits: Short breaks restore attention, improve creativity, and prevent mental fatigue
- Context switching cost: It takes 23 minutes to regain focus after an interruption
- Optimal break activities: Movement, nature exposure, and mindfulness are most restorative
Maximizing Your Focus Sessions
Follow these practices to get the most from your focus sessions:
- Prepare your workspace: Clear clutter, adjust lighting, and minimize distractions before starting
- Define clear goals: Know exactly what you'll accomplish in each session
- Use the first 5 minutes: Review goals and plan your approach before diving in
- Track interruptions: Note what distracts you and address it between sessions
- Respect the timer: Stop when the timer ends, even if you're in flow. This prevents burnout.
- Take real breaks: Step away from your workspace. Don't check email or social media.
- Review and adjust: At the end of the day, review what worked and adjust your approach
Energy Management Throughout the Day
Your energy levels naturally fluctuate throughout the day:
- Morning (9-11 AM): Peak cognitive performance. Schedule your most challenging tasks.
- Mid-morning (11-12 PM): Still high energy. Good for complex problem-solving.
- Early afternoon (1-3 PM): Post-lunch dip. Schedule lighter tasks or administrative work.
- Late afternoon (3-5 PM): Second wind. Good for creative work or meetings.
- Evening (after 5 PM): Energy declining. Wind down with routine tasks.
